Bristol City V Port Vale at Ashton Gate - Match Preview

Moore missing for RobinsBristol City look set to be without goalkeeper Simon Moore when they take on Port Vale.The Cardiff loanee will return to training this week but having been sidelined with a groin injury since the 3-0 loss to Sheffield United in late February this match looks to have come too soon for the former Brentford shotstopper.And the Robins will also be without Adam El-Abd for the Ashton Gate clash as the defender serves the final game of his three-match ban.Martin Paterson will hope to keep his place having netted eight minutes into full debut having arrived on loan from Huddersfield.Port Vale have been dealt an injury blow ahead of the trip with the news that goalkeeper Chris Neal is likely to miss the rest of the season with ankle ligament damage.Neal was carried off on a stretcher during the 3-2 home win over Tranmere on Saturday following a challenge from Rovers defender Ian Goodison.Vale assistant manager Mark Grew confirmed at the club's pre-match press conference on Monday that Sam Johnson will play against the Robins on Tuesday night, while development squad keeper Ryan Boot has been recalled from his loan spell at Worcester City and will travel to Ashton Gate as back up.Midfielder Chris Lines will serve the second game of a two-match ban while defender Liam Chilvers is recovering from a groin operation
